Generate randomized English Markdown frontend design directions from curated catalogs.

TypeScript MCP server that returns randomized English Markdown frontend design directions. It uses curated catalogs and optional soft compatibility scoring. It does not call an LLM. Use the published npm package from any MCP client that supports stdio servers: returns one randomized Markdown design direction. Verification confirms publisher identity (repo ownership), not code safety. The security scan covers known CVEs and suspicious install scripts — it cannot prove the absence of malicious code.
